Contributions to the fast growth that happened after the end of the civil war: Technological advances: electric writing, automobiles, x-rays, photographs. Electrical steel industries: rise of the railroad. Most powerful form of transportation is the locomotive. 53 thousand miles of railroad laid down. Massive amounts of labor needed to create the railroad. Leads to large amounts of immigration to do this work. 1869 - first continental railroad used: labor and goods can be shipped quickly back and forth between the regions. Creates new jobs, towns, goods for trade. Raw goods have a new way to travel to be manufactured in the cities and then back again to be shipped out from the city to the places it can be bought.
